WHY CHOCOLATE CAN BE DANGEROUS TO PETS – KEEP THEM SAFE

Have you ever wondered why your vet insists that chocolate is strictly off-limits for dogs? It’s not just a precaution; chocolate contains theobromine and caffeine, stimulants that are harmless to humans in small quantities but toxic to our canine companions.
